The purpose is to verify whether the wearable vital sign system can continuously measure blood pressure and glucose by the pulse wave form detected using a FBG (fiber bragg grating) censer developed by Shinshu University.
Others
The second purpose is to verify the mechanism how the pulse wave form detected by a FBG censer provide the accuracy of blood pressure and glucose.

FBG sensor signal supported the diameter of radial artery conjugation, and it became clear that this accorded with the pressure of the fluid, and the shape of the pulsation distortion signal changed by age and was an estimate in blood vessel age or arteriosclerotic possibility from a wave pattern shape. Blood pressure calculation was possible as a parameter with the size of the vertical axis direction of the pulsation distortion wave pattern.
